VeriSign, Inc. reported first-quarter 2026 results with revenue of US$428.9 million and net income of US$214.5 million, raised full-year guidance, and its board approved a US$0.81 per-share cash dividend payable on May 27, 2026. The company also highlighted a record .com and .net domain base, strengthening its position at the core of global internet infrastructure while preparing for a wholesale .com price increase in November 2026.
